Zastanawiałem się, czy istnieje sposób na skomponowanie programu z wieloma obwodami kwantowymi bez ponownej inicjalizacji rejestru dla wartości dla każdego obwodu.000 W szczególności chciałbym uruchomić drugi obwód kwantowy po uruchomieniu pierwszego, jak w tym przykładzie: qp = QuantumProgram() qr = qp.create_quantum_register('qr',2) cr = qp.create_classical_register('cr',2) qc1 = qp.create_circuit('B1',[qr],[cr]) qc1.x(qr) qc1.measure(qr[0], cr[0]) …
Komputery kwantowe w pułapce jonowej należą do najbardziej obiecujących metod obliczeń kwantowych na dużą skalę. Ogólna idea polega na zakodowaniu kubitów w stanach elektronicznych każdego jonu, a następnie kontroli jonów za pomocą sił elektromagnetycznych. W tym kontekście często widzę, że eksperymentalna realizacja wykorzystania pułapkowanych systemów jonowych 40Ca+40Ca+{}^{40}\!\operatorname{Ca}^+Jony Ca + (patrz …
Oświadczenie: Jestem inżynierem oprogramowania, który interesuje się obliczeniami kwantowymi. Chociaż rozumiem kilka podstawowych pojęć, teorii i matematyki, w żadnym wypadku nie mam doświadczenia w tej dziedzinie. Robię wstępne badania stanu rozwoju oprogramowania kwantowego. Częścią moich badań jest ocena QDK Microsoftu i niektórych jego próbek (napisanych w Q #). Jak rozumiem, …
Obecnie prowadzę samokształcenie, korzystając przede wszystkim z książki: Quantum Computing a Gentle Introduction autorstwa Eleanor Rieffel i Wolfganga Polaka. Poruszanie się we wcześniejszych rozdziałach i ćwiczeniach poszło całkiem dobrze (na szczęście we wcześniejszych rozdziałach było mnóstwo przykładów), jednak utknąłem w 5. rozdziale o obwodach kwantowych. Chociaż rozumiem pojęcia przedstawione przez …
Rozważ następującą grę: Rzucam uczciwą monetą i w zależności od wyniku (główki / reszki) dam ci jeden z następujących stanów: |0⟩ or cos(x)|0⟩+sin(x)|1⟩.|0⟩ or cos(x)|0⟩+sin(x)|1⟩.|0\rangle \text{ or } \cos(x)|0\rangle + \sin(x)|1\rangle. Tutaj, xxxjest znanym stałym kątem. Ale nie mówię wam, jaki stan wam daję. Jak mogę opisać procedurę pomiaru (tj. …
W Ulepszonej symulacji układów stabilizatora autorstwa Aaronsona i Gottesmana wyjaśniono, jak obliczyć tabelę opisującą, które produkty tensora Pauliego, na które obserwowane są X i Z każdego kubitu, są odwzorowywane, gdy działa na nie obwód Clifforda. Tutaj jako przykład obwodu Clifford: 0: -------@-----------X--- | | 1: ---@---|---@---@---@--- | | | | …
Pytanie zainspirowane tym artykułem z IEEE Spectrum na temat bloków zawierających różne filtry polaryzacyjne do użytku w salach lekcyjnych oraz moje poprzednie pytanie dotyczące reprezentowania eksperymentu z trzema filtrami polaryzacyjnymi w kategoriach obliczeń kwantowych. Tutaj chcę iść w drugą stronę. Czy istnieją jakieś łatwo dostępne do kupienia edukacyjne kwantowe zabawki …
W literaturze na temat QECC bramy Clifford zajmują podwyższony status. Rozważ następujące przykłady, które to potwierdzają: Podczas studiowania kodów stabilizatora oddzielnie uczysz się, jak wykonać zakodowane bramki Clifford (nawet jeśli nie mają one zastosowania poprzecznie). Wszystkie materiały wprowadzające na temat QECC kładą nacisk na wykonywanie zakodowanych operacji Clifforda na kodach …
Przyglądałem się aplikacjom obliczeń kwantowych do uczenia maszynowego i natknąłem się na następujący przedruk z 2003 roku. Algorytmy kwantowej konwolucji i korelacji są fizycznie niemożliwe . Artykuł nie wydaje się być opublikowany w żadnym czasopiśmie, ale cytowano go kilkadziesiąt razy. Autor artykułu twierdzi, że niemożliwe jest obliczenie dyskretnego splotu ponad …
Numer Boga jest najgorszym przypadku algorytmu Boga , który jest koncepcja wywodząca się z dyskusji na temat sposobów rozwiązania zagadki Kostka Rubika, ale która może być również zastosowana w innych łamigłówkach kombinacyjnych i grach matematycznych. Odnosi się do dowolnego algorytmu, który wytwarza rozwiązanie o możliwie najmniejszej liczbie ruchów, przy czym …
W Q-Kit stworzyłem prosty obwód do zrozumienia bramek warunkowych i stanów wyjściowych na każdym kroku: Na początku jest wyraźny stan 00, który jest wejściem Pierwszy kubit przechodzi przez bramę Hadamarda, przechodzi w superpozycję, 00 i 10 stają się jednakowo możliwe Pierwszy kubot CNOT jest drugim, prawdopodobieństwo 00 jest niezmienione, ale …
Czy istnieje jakaś definicja lub twierdzenie o tym, co komputer kwantowy może osiągnąć, dzięki którym postkrystaliczne schematy kryptograficzne (np. Kryptografia sieci, ale nie kryptografia kwantowa) mogą uzasadniać ich bezpieczeństwo? Wiem, że funkcja znajdowania okresu jest w stanie złamać RSA i dyskretne dzienniki, ale czy jest to jedyny algorytm mający znaczenie …
Aby zaimplementować pewien algorytm kwantowy, muszę zbudować bramę Z-kubit (w tym przypadku trzy-kubit) sterowaną Z z zestawu bramek elementarnych, jak pokazano na poniższym rysunku. . Bramy, z których mogę skorzystać, są bramy Pauli X,Y,ZX,Y,Z\rm X, Y, Z i wszystkie ich moce (tj. wszystkie obroty Pauliego aż do współczynnika fazowego), exp(iθ|11⟩⟨11|)exp(iθ|11⟩⟨11|){\rm …
To pytanie jest kontynuacją poprzedniego pytania QCSE: „ Czy stany wykresów qudit są dobrze zdefiniowane dla wymiaru innego niż podstawowy? ”. Z odpowiedzi na pytanie wydaje się, że nie ma nic złego w definiowaniu stanów wykresu za pomocąddd-wymiarowe qudity, jednak wydaje się, że inne aspekty definiujące stany grafowe nie rozciągają …
Używamy plików cookie i innych technologii śledzenia w celu poprawy komfortu przeglądania naszej witryny, aby wyświetlać spersonalizowane treści i ukierunkowane reklamy, analizować ruch w naszej witrynie, i zrozumieć, skąd pochodzą nasi goście.
Kontynuując, wyrażasz zgodę na korzystanie z plików cookie i innych technologii śledzenia oraz potwierdzasz, że masz co najmniej 16 lat lub zgodę rodzica lub opiekuna.